## Dispatcher Limits & Quotas

Quick refresher for the sync: the Bramblehop driver-assignment heuristic doesn't consider every driver — it scores a capped candidate pool within a search radius, and bails out early once a score clears the acceptance threshold. If the pool comes up empty, the radius expands a fixed number of times before we fall back to manual dispatch. All of this is governed by the constants below.

tuning table, tahof-hahaf:
BUDGETS = {
    "juleth": 227,
    "zoreth": 361,
}

## Deployment

Branchsweep runs as a single container on the Ketterly ops host. Deploys are automatic on merge; support should never redeploy manually. If the bot stops archiving stale branches, restart the container and check the dry-run flag first — most tickets trace back to it. Escalate anything else to the platform channel. The bot boots with the configuration shown below.

config for kajef-hahof:
[ulamir]
port = 5672
region = central-1
host = ulamir.lumicsys.corp
timeout_ms = 2000
retries = 3

## Authentication

Dedupewright, our on-call alert deduplicator, requires authentication for every call to its merge and suppress endpoints. New team members should note that dedupe rules are scoped per team, so your credentials determine which alert streams you can collapse. Tokens are issued by the Hollowmere identity service and expire every ninety days; the deploy pipeline handles rotation automatically. For local development and running the integration suite, authenticate against the staging instance using the key that follows.

service key, fawip-bajef: kto11_Qt5wZK9vdNC

Q: Why does the Millbrae Hearth ordering portal enforce a 2 p.m. cutoff, and how is it overridden?

A: The cutoff prevents backdated orders from altering settled batch ledgers. Overrides are restricted to the duty manager account, which auto-locks after misuse. Restoring that account requires the documented recovery flow, which prompts for the passphrase recorded immediately below.

unlock words, hahip-yagef: zorok-novmir-zorix-silax